Description
Petitioners
Thomas de Kercolston, son of William son of John de Kercolston.
Name(s)
de Kercolston, Thomas
Addressees
King and council
Nature of request
The petitioner seeks a writ from the king to his justices that he should not have been outlawed for various robberies in Nottinghamshire before Herle and his fellow itinerant justices, because at the time he was imprisoned in Northampton Castle (by the statute of Acton Burnell) in the custody of the sheriff.
Nature of endorsement
Let the record and process of his outlawry be brought into chancery and examined, and order that justices be assigned to adjudge the petition by writ of the chancery and determine whether he was outlawed against right and reason.
Places mentioned
Nottingham, [Nottinghamshire]
Northampton, [Northamptonshire]
People mentioned
William [de Kercolston], father of the petitioner
John de Kercolston, grandfather of the petitioner
William de Herle
Note
From the modern endorsement, which suggests that this case relates to the period of the eyre of Northampton (1329-1330).
